在互联网时代,DNS(域名系统)劫持已经成为了一种常见的网络安全威胁。它不仅侵犯了用户的隐私,还可能导致用户访问非法网站,甚至遭受经济损失。本文将深入解析DNS劫持的原理、危害以及如何保护自己免受其侵害。
DNS劫持的定义
DNS劫持,是指攻击者通过篡改DNS解析过程,将用户的查询请求引导至攻击者指定的恶意网站。一旦用户访问这些网站,其隐私和信息安全将受到严重威胁。
DNS劫持的原理
DNS解析过程:当用户输入一个网址时,浏览器首先向本地的DNS服务器发送请求,查询该网址对应的IP地址。如果本地DNS服务器无法解析,则继续向上一级DNS服务器查询,直至解析成功。
攻击者介入:攻击者通过以下几种方式介入DNS解析过程:
- 篡改本地DNS设置:攻击者可以修改用户电脑的DNS设置,使其指向攻击者的DNS服务器。
- DNS服务器漏洞:攻击者利用DNS服务器的安全漏洞,篡改DNS解析结果。
- 中间人攻击:攻击者在用户与目标网站之间建立连接,拦截用户的DNS请求,篡改解析结果。
DNS劫持的危害
- 窃取隐私:攻击者可以窃取用户的登录凭证、个人信息等,用于非法用途。
- 传播恶意软件:攻击者将用户引导至恶意网站,诱导用户下载恶意软件,如病毒、木马等。
- 经济损失:攻击者可以诱导用户进行虚假交易,骗取钱财。
- 破坏声誉:企业或个人网站被劫持后,可能遭受声誉损失。
如何防范DNS劫持
- 使用安全DNS服务:选择可靠的DNS服务提供商,如谷歌DNS、OpenDNS等。
- 设置本地DNS服务器:将本地DNS服务器设置为安全DNS服务提供商的地址。
- 启用防火墙和杀毒软件:防火墙和杀毒软件可以阻止恶意软件的入侵。
- 定期更新操作系统和软件:保持操作系统和软件的更新,修复安全漏洞。
- 提高安全意识:了解DNS劫持的危害,增强网络安全意识。
总结
DNS劫持是一种隐蔽的网络安全隐患,对用户隐私和数据安全构成威胁。了解DNS劫持的原理和危害,掌握防范方法,是每个网民都应该具备的网络安全素养。
